Have there been any changes between 1.4.2 and 1.5.2 that would require one to upgrade to intermediate versions before upgrading to 1.5.2, or can one upgrade from 1.4.2 to 1.5.2 directly?

You can upgrade from absolutely any release, including betas, to any later release, and the database will be migrated step-by-step as required.